Select a type of renewable energy. Compare it to fossil fuels by explaining two pros and two cons for its implementation on a la
myrzilka [38]

Answer:

Bio gas

Explanation:

Bio gas is gotten from the anaerobic breaking down of biomass especially animal waste.

PROS:

A. it is renewable: biogas is renewable and has an endless supply of material since animals are the main source when compared to fossil fuels.

B. It doesn't involve a rigorous mining exersice to get to like fossil fuels and it is in accessible abundance.

CON:

A. A lot of waste is needed for the product of biogas and the final waste (sludge) from the production process can be a huge problem to dispose off.

B. Some of the gases liberated in the manufacturing process are greenhouse gas, especially methane. These gases if let out, will contribute immensly to global warming.
